This week’s ride is a double feature— The BBC will be hosting a group ride with the NFBC, but this is also a scored BBC Sunday Series Club Race!

All season long, the BBC is partnering with the NFBC (Niagara Frontier Bicycle Club) for our group rides!  We expect a lot of road riders on our group rides of a wide range of abilities.  We will have A, B, and C group leaders that will hold each group to a prescribed pace so everyone has a group to ride with.  Please listen to the instructions in the parking lot from our ride leaders and head out and stay together for a great ride!  This collaboration between the BBC and NFBC will get more of us riding together and riders from each club trying out the other.

As we head out, this ride will have 5 uphill Strava segments that will be the designated fast segments.  We’ll ride to each as a group, start the segments together and race to the top.  We’ll stop and regroup after each hilly segment.  For this ride, the A and B groups will ride together so that all BBC members can be scored properly, followed by the C group.  This race will be scored based on your accumulated time across all segments according to your uploaded Strava file, lowest time wins.  The C group will not be scored, so it will be a fully cooperative group ride.

Scoring will be done that evening and announced Monday morning, so please upload your ride when you get home.  While Strava is highly recommended, if you do not have Strava, please report your placing on each segment to a ride leader with the names of the BBC members who finished next to you so we can give you an approximate time.

 

Start and Parking: Chestnut Ridge Park in the upper lot by the tennis courts.

Our group ride this week is a 35-mile route starting from Chestnut Ridge that has 5 scored Strava segments.  Your cumulative time across all 5 on your Strava file will determine the final leaderboard!

Sunday Series Club Races Individual Scoring:

This race is part of the club’s eleven-race points series. There will be an ‘A’ and ‘B’ field scored at each race, with additional separate scoring below. Points are awarded in each race by finishing place:

1st = 15 points

2nd = 13 points

3rd = 11 points

4th = 9 points

5th = 7 points

6th = 6 points

7th = 5 points

8th = 4 points

9th = 3 points

10th = 2 points

11th and after = 1 point each

 

Each rider’s best nine of eleven results will be used for the overall standings and the top three overall riders will be awarded at the end of season banquet.

Master’s Sunday Series Racing

New in 2023, we are including a version of separate scoring for Masters Men’s 50+ racers!  Master’s 50+ will race in the A field and will be scored against the A’s, but Master’s points will be pulled out into a separate Master’s leaderboard.  How does this work?  If Master’s 50+ riders get 4th, 7th, and 8th in the A race, their 4th/7th/8th place points will go towards their Master’s standings.  They’ll be on the Men’s A leaderboard and the separate Master’s leaderboard.

Women’s Sunday Series Racing

Women racing in the Men’s A field will have the same version of separate scoring as the Men’s Master’s 50+ above.  If women riders get 4th/7th/8th in the Men’s A race, their 4th/7th/8th place points will go towards a Women’s A leaderboard, as well as the Men’s A leaderboard.

Women racing in the Men’s B field will have the same version of separate scoring as well.  If women get 4th/7th/8th in the Men’s B race, their 4th/7th/8th place points will go towards a Women’s B leaderboard, as well as the Men’s B leaderboard.

Sunday Series Team Scoring:

There will be team scoring in only the full ‘A’ field (including the master’s and women racing in the A field). ALL eleven races count toward the team classification. There are no restrictions on the number of riders per team, per race, but only the top three riders of each team will have their points totaled after each race for their team classification scoring. The overall winner will be awarded at the end of season banquet.
